Gas Discharge Tube 2R90 – Vehicle Power Supply & Charging Station Protection
This Gas Discharge Tube provides essential high-voltage protection and surge suppression for critical electrical applications. Designed with robust construction and reliable performance, it safeguards sensitive equipment from voltage spikes and transient surges in demanding environments.
Key Features
- High-voltage gas discharge tube for reliable surge protection
- Operating temperature range: -40°C to +85°C for versatile environmental applications
- Axial termination style for easy circuit integration
- Relative humidity tolerance: ≤75% RH for stable performance in humid conditions
- Voltage rating: Up to 1000V for high-voltage scenarios
- Failsafe protection mechanism for enhanced safety
- Ionization tube assembly for efficient overvoltage protection
- Durable construction suitable for various electronic devices
Technical Specifications
| Agency Recognition |
UL |
| Operating Temperature |
-40°C to +85°C |
| Number of Electrodes |
2 Electrode |
| Impulse Discharge Current |
2KA |
| Electrode Capacitance |
<1PF |
| Termination Style |
Axial |
| Lead Diameter |
1.5mm |
| Size |
φ8*10mm |
| Voltage Characteristics |
High Voltage |
| Impulse Voltage |
≤1100V |

Frequently Asked Questions
What is a Gas Discharge Tube (GDT) used for?
A Gas Discharge Tube protects electronic circuits from high voltage surges and transient voltage spikes by safely diverting excess energy to ground.

How do I choose the right Gas Discharge Tube for my application?
Choosing the right GDT depends on voltage rating, current capacity, and response time requirements. Consult the product datasheet or contact the manufacturer for guidance.
